Prototype to production ML in days? Well apparently, you might do that with a new open source ML framework that generates dynamic nested graphs of ML pipeline steps (as Python functions). Sematic enables you to quickly prototype and productise complex ML pipelines with minimalistic Python APIs. It also brings Jupyter Notebooks to the actual ML pipeline.
